Quick Summary:
Minnie Cooper thinks her birthday is unlucky. Born in the wee hours of New Year’s Day, she narrowly missed the cash prize for being the first baby born in London, 1990. That prize went to Quinn Hamilton. And the intervening years have convinced Minnie that her unlucky streak has continued while Quinn has seemed to be luck personified. A chance meeting at a New Year’s party on their mutual thirtieth birthday beings a series of chance meeting than inexplicably keep bringing them together.

About the Author
Sophie Cousens started her career in television, where she produced, among other things, The Graham Norton Show, Big Brother, Ant and Dec and Russell Howard’s Good News. Working in TV taught her three things;
1 – Wearing a lanyard makes you look as though you know what you are doing.
2 -The best phrase you can contribute in meetings is “let’s action that!”If you say it often enough, hopefully someone else will do your work for you.
3 – If in doubt, find someone wearing a lanyard – they’ll know what to do.
Sophie currently lives in Jersey where she now writes full time. She lives with her husband Tim and has two small children who keep her occupied with important questions such as ‘but did Cinderella have a toothbrush?’ and ‘do giraffe’s know they have really long necks?’ She yearns for a time when she will be able to add a miniature dachshund to the party.
